Mars Hill in Seventh Place After Opening Round of Cherokee Valley Invitational
Sarah Johnson leads Mars Hill with a 78.
TRAVELERS REST, S.C.- Sarah Johnson shot a six-over-par 78 to lead Mars Hill in the opening round of the Cherokee Valley Invitational on Monday held at the par-72, 5,901-yard Cherokee Valley Golf Club.
Johnson is tied with four other golfers for eighth place. Victoria Barrett fired an 82 and is tied for 19th. Emma Lundvall shot an 83, putting her in a six player tie for 22nd. Lindsey Ball finished with an opening round 93, followed by Raven Brown with a 94. The Lions are in seventh place with a 336, two shots behind fifth place.
Julia Kaeding of Mount Olive and Grace Glaze of Queens each finished with a three-over-par 75 to tie for the lead after the first round. Mount Olive is the team leader by three strokes over Queens with an opening round 304.
The tournament will conclude on Tuesday.
